SQL Server 2005 SP3
Microsoft will release a third service pack for SQL Server 2005, just before the next version of the server software comes out. Service Pack 3 is expected to come out after the release to manufacturing of SQL Server 2008, which is scheduled to happen in the third quarter this year.
Microsoft didn't reveal much about what the service pack would include, except to say in a Tuesday blog post that it will contain all cumulative updates to the software plus some additional fixes to bugs that customers have reported on MS Connect, a Microsoft Web site for customer feedback.
